Read the following passage and identify the main idea using emphasis word clues to help you.
 
  Cheating is a serious problem on most college campuses. Students cheat for many reasons: they may not have studied enough so they copy from the smarter student next to them; they may feel pressured to excel in order to get into a specific program; or they may have the idea that everyone does it so it's okay. However, an often overlooked reason for cheating is that students do not realize that some of their actions constitute dishonesty. For example, it is not always clear to students when working together on an assignment is allowable and when it is not. Or students may not realize that even if they have restated an idea in their own words, they must still give credit to the person whose ideas they have used in their essay. Therefore, professors should not assume that all cheating is deliberate on the student's part.
